Overview
Embark on a majestic 9-day cultural expedition through Russia’s most iconic cities and ancient towns. Begin in Moscow with the Kremlin, Red Square, and Metro tour, followed by the serene Golden Ring cities—Suzdal, Vladimir, and Bogolubovo—where Russian history and orthodoxy come alive. Ride the bullet train to imperial St. Petersburg to admire the Hermitage Museum, Peterhof Palace, and Isaakiy Cathedral. Guided by local experts and enriched with immersive experiences, this tour is a perfect blend of modern cities and timeless heritage.

VISA Information
Travelers to Russia require a valid tourist visa. We can assist in providing the visa support documents (invitation letter). However, visa processing and payment must be handled by the traveler through their local consulate or visa center. Apply at least 3-4 weeks before departure. A passport valid for at least 6 months from the travel date is required.
Know Before You Go
· Carry a printed copy of your visa and hotel
confirmations.
· Russia uses the Russian Ruble (RUB) –
exchange currency in official counters.
· Internet access is widely available, but
carry an international SIM or local SIM for convenience.
· Dress in layers and bring comfortable walking
shoes.
· Be prepared for airport and station security
checks.
· Most museums are closed on Mondays – all scheduled tours are planned accordingly.
